> Erasure Coding: Decommission may generate the parity block's content with all 
> 0 in some case
> 
>
> Key: HDFS-15186
> URL: https://issues.apache.org/jira/browse/HDFS-15186
> Project: Hadoop HDFS
>  Issue Type: Bug
>  Components: datanode, erasure-coding
>Affects Versions: 3.0.3, 3.2.1, 3.1.3
>Reporter: Yao Guangdong
>Assignee: Yao Guangdong
>Priority: Critical
> Attachments: HDFS-15186.001.patch, HDFS-15186.002.patch, 
> HDFS-15186.003.patch, HDFS-15186.004.patch
>
>
> I can find some parity block's content with all 0 when i decommission some 
> DataNode(more than 1) from a cluster. And the probability is very big(parts 
> per thousand).This is a big problem.You can think that if we read data from 
> the zero parity block or use the zero parity block to recover a block which 
> can make us use the error data even we don't know it.
> There is some case in the below:
> B: Busy DataNode, 
> D:Decommissioning DataNode,
> Others is normal.
> 1.Group indices is [0, 1, 2, 3, 4, 5, 6(B,D), 7, 8(D)].
> 2.Group indices is [0(B,D), 1, 2, 3, 4, 5, 6(B,D), 7, 8(D)].
> 
> In the first case when the block group indices is [0, 1, 2, 3, 4, 5, 6(B,D), 
> 7, 8(D)], the DN may received reconstruct block command and the 
> liveIndices=[0, 1, 2, 3, 4, 5, 7, 8] and the targets's(the field which  in 
> the class StripedReconstructionInfo) length is 2. 
> The targets's length is 2 which mean that the DataNode need recover 2 
> internal block in current code.But from the liveIndices we only can find 1 
> missing block, so the method StripedWriter#initTargetIndices will use 0 as 
> the default recover block and don't care the indices 0 is in the sources 
> indices or not.
> When they use sources indices [0, 1, 2, 3, 4, 5] to recover indices [6, 0] 
> use the ec algorithm.We can find that the indices [0] is in the both the 
> sources indices and the targets indices in this case. The returned target 
> buffer in the indices [6] is always 0 from the ec  algorithm.So I think this 
> is the ec algorithm's problem. Because it should more fault tolerance.I try 
> to fixed it .But it is too hard. Because the case is too more. The second is 
> another case in the example above(use sources indices [1, 2, 3, 4, 5, 7] to 
> recover indices [0, 6, 0]). So I changed my mind.Invoke the ec  algorithm 
> with a correct parameters. Which mean that remove the duplicate target 
> indices 0 in this case.Finally, I fixed it in this way.

> Crashing bugs in NameNode when using a valid configuration for 
> `dfs.namenode.audit.loggers`
> ---
>
> Key: HDFS-15124
> URL: https://issues.apache.org/jira/browse/HDFS-15124
> Project: Hadoop HDFS
>  Issue Type: Bug
>  Components: namenode
>Affects Versions: 2.10.0
>Reporter: Ctest
>Assignee: Ctest
>Priority: Critical
> Attachments: HDFS-15124.000.patch, HDFS-15124.001.patch, 
> HDFS-15124.002.patch, HDFS-15124.003.patch, HDFS-15124.004.patch, 
> HDFS-15124.005.patch, HDFS-15124.006.patch
>
>
> I am using Hadoop-2.10.0.
> The configuration parameter `dfs.namenode.audit.loggers` allows `default` 
> (which is the default value) and 
> `org.apache.hadoop.hdfs.server.namenode.top.TopAuditLogger`.
> When I use `org.apache.hadoop.hdfs.server.namenode.top.TopAuditLogger`, 
> namenode will not be started successfully because of an 
> `InstantiationException` thrown from 
> `org.apache.hadoop.hdfs.server.namenode.FSNamesystem.initAuditLoggers`. 
> The root cause is that while initializing namenode, `initAuditLoggers` will 
> be called and it will try to call the default constructor of 
> `org.apache.hadoop.hdfs.server.namenode.top.TopAuditLogger` which doesn't 
> have a default constructor. Thus the `InstantiationException` exception is 
> thrown.

> Improving the error message for missing 
> `dfs.namenode.rpc-address.$NAMESERVICE`
> ---
>
> Key: HDFS-15193
> URL: https://issues.apache.org/jira/browse/HDFS-15193
> Project: Hadoop HDFS
>  Issue Type: Bug
>  Components: hdfs
>Reporter: Ctest
>Priority: Major
> Attachments: HDFS-15193-001.patch
>
>
> I set `dfs.nameservices` with the value of one name service (let’s say `ns1` 
> for simplicity) and forgot to set `dfs.namenode.rpc-address.ns1`. 
> Then I got an error message:
> {code:java}
> [ERROR] testNonFederation(org.apache.hadoop.hdfs.tools.TestGetConf)  Time 
> elapsed: 0.195 s <<< ERROR!
> java.io.IOException: Incorrect configuration: namenode address 
> dfs.namenode.servicerpc-address or dfs.namenode.rpc-address is not configured.
> at 
> org.apache.hadoop.hdfs.DFSUtil.getNNServiceRpcAddressesForCluster(DFSUtil.java:629)
> at 
> org.apache.hadoop.hdfs.tools.TestGetConf.getAddressListFromConf(TestGetConf.java:132)
> at 
> org.apache.hadoop.hdfs.tools.TestGetConf.verifyAddresses(TestGetConf.java:234)
> at 
> org.apache.hadoop.hdfs.tools.TestGetConf.testNonFederation(TestGetConf.java:308)
> at sun.reflect.NativeMethodAccessorImpl.invoke0(Native Method)
> at 
> sun.reflect.NativeMethodAccessorImpl.invoke(NativeMethodAccessorImpl.java:62)
> at 
> sun.reflect.DelegatingMethodAccessorImpl.invoke(DelegatingMethodAccessorImpl.java:43)
> at java.lang.reflect.Method.invoke(Method.java:498)
> at 
> org.junit.runners.model.FrameworkMethod$1.runReflectiveCall(FrameworkMethod.java:50)
> at 
> org.junit.internal.runners.model.ReflectiveCallable.run(ReflectiveCallable.java:12)
> at 
> org.junit.runners.model.FrameworkMethod.invokeExplosively(FrameworkMethod.java:47)
> at 
> org.junit.internal.runners.statements.InvokeMethod.evaluate(InvokeMethod.java:17)
> at 
> org.junit.internal.runners.statements.FailOnTimeout$CallableStatement.call(FailOnTimeout.java:298)
> at 
> org.junit.internal.runners.statements.FailOnTimeout$CallableStatement.call(FailOnTimeout.java:292)
> at java.util.concurrent.FutureTask.run(FutureTask.java:266)
> at java.lang.Thread.run(Thread.java:748)
> {code}
>  
> The error message above told me that `dfs.namenode.rpc-address` or 
> `dfs.namenode.servicerpc-address` should be set.
> However, the actual reason for the error is that 
> `dfs.namenode.rpc-address.ns1` or `dfs.namenode.servicerpc-address.ns1` is 
> not set.
>  
> *How to improve* 
> I wrote a patch to improve the error message. Here is the current error 
> message:
> {code:java}
> [ERROR] testNonFederation(org.apache.hadoop.hdfs.tools.TestGetConf)  Time 
> elapsed: 0.195 s <<< ERROR!
> java.io.IOException: Incorrect configuration: namenode address 
> dfs.namenode.servicerpc-address[.$NAMESERVICE] or 
> dfs.namenode.rpc-address[.$NAMESERVICE] is not configured.
> {code}
> Then the users can immediately know that they should set 
> `dfs.namenode.rpc-address.ns1` or `dfs.namenode.servicerpc-address.ns1` 
> according to the error message.

> Reset LowRedundancyBlocks Iterator periodically
> ---
>
> Key: HDFS-14861
> URL: https://issues.apache.org/jira/browse/HDFS-14861
> Project: Hadoop HDFS
>  Issue Type: Improvement
>  Components: namenode
>Affects Versions: 3.3.0
>Reporter: Stephen O'Donnell
>Assignee: Stephen O'Donnell
>Priority: Major
>  Labels: decommission
> Fix For: 3.3.0, 3.1.4, 3.2.2
>
> Attachments: HDFS-14861.001.patch, HDFS-14861.002.patch
>
>
> When the namenode needs to schedule blocks for reconstruction, the blocks are 
> placed into the neededReconstruction object in the BlockManager. This is an 
> instance of LowRedundancyBlocks, which maintains a list of priority queues 
> where the blocks are held until they are scheduled for reconstruction / 
> replication.
> Every 3 seconds, by default, a number of blocks are retrieved from 
> LowRedundancyBlocks. The method 
> LowRedundancyBlocks.chooseLowRedundancyBlocks() is used to retrieve the next 
> set of blocks using a bookmarked iterator. Each call to this method moves the 
> iterator forward. The number of blocks retrieved is governed by the formula:
> number_of_live_nodes * dfs.namenode.replication.work.multiplier.per.iteration 
> (default 2)
> Then the namenode attempts to schedule those blocks on datanodes, but each 
> datanode has a limit of how many blocks can be queued against it (controlled 
> by dfs.namenode.replication.max-streams) so all of the retrieved blocks may 
> not be scheduled. There may be other block availability reasons the blocks 
> are not scheduled too.
> As the iterator in chooseLowRedundancyBlocks() always moves forward, the 
> blocks which were not scheduled are not retried until the end of the queue is 
> reached and the iterator is reset.
> If the replication queue is very large (eg several nodes are being 
> decommissioned) or if blocks are being continuously added to the replication 
> queue (eg nodes decommission using the proposal in HDFS-14854) it may take a 
> very long time for the iterator to be reset to the start.
> The result of this, could be a few blocks for a decommissioning or entering 
> maintenance mode node getting left behind and it taking many hours or even 
> days for them to be retried, and this could stop decommission completing.
> With this Jira, I would like to suggest we reset the iterator after a 
> configurable number of calls to chooseLowRedundancyBlocks() so any left 
> behind blocks are retried.
